    제품 설명

    Fluo-4 AM is a cell-permeable Ca2+ (calcium ion) indicator (Ex/Em = 485/526 nm)[1].

    In Vitro

    Guide (Following is our recommended protocol. This protocol only provides a guideline, and should be modified according to your specific needs)
    . 1. Solution preparation[1]
    1.1 Preparation of storage solution
    Solvent: DMSO
    Concentration: 1 mM is recommended (e.g. weigh 100 μg Fluo-4 AM and dissolve in 96.16 μL solvent).
    Storage: Use as soon as possible and avoid long-term storage.
    1.2 Preparation of working solution
    Dilute with buffer (e.g. HHBS containing 0.04% Poloxamer 407 (F127) (HY-D1005)) to 1 M (optimized according to the experiment).
    Note: The working solution should be prepared and used immediately, and protected from light.

    2. Cell staining

    2.1 Count the cells and take 106 cells from each sample (control and experiment/s).
    2.2 Collect the cells (5 min, 3000×g, 4 °C) and wash once in PBS.
    2.3 Resuspend the cells in PBS and add Fluo-4-AM (1 mM stock) to a final concentration of 1 μM. Incubate at 37 °C for 1 h.
    2. 4 Wash the cells three times (2 min, 3000×g) with PBS and finally resuspend in 1 mL PBS.
    2.5 Evaluate the staining by flow cytometry (Ex/Em = 485/526 nm).

    Cell Assay 
    [1]

    For measuring fluorescence from cells in suspension, dilutions to 2 to 3×106 cells are made, from cultures of rat basophilic leukemia (RBL) cells. Cells are incubated in suspension in 1 μM dye (including Fluo-4 AM) for 30 min at 37°C. Cell suspensions are then transferred to cuvets for measurements of fluorescence emission intensity by spectrofluorometer[1].
